Research Abstract

A tryptophan-catabolizing enzyme, indoleamine 2,3-dioxygenase (IDO), is reported to be an inducer of immune tolerance. Our aim was to clarify whether IDO is activated or not in chronic hepatitis C patients (CHC) and its role in immune responses. Serum kynurenine concentration in CHC patients was significantly higher than those in healthy donors, the levels of which were positively correlated with histological activity or fibrosis scores. IDO activity in IDO-DCs from the patients was significantly higher than those from the donors. Furthermore, IDO-DCs from the patients induced more regulatory T cells (Tregs) compared to those from donors. In patients with IL28B minor genotype, Kyn concentration was lower in SVR patients in Peg-IFNα/ribavirin therapy than those in non -SVR patients.In conclusion, systemic IDO activity is enhanced in CHC patients in correlation with the degree of liver inflammation and fibrosis. IDO-DCs from the patients are prone to induce Tregs, resulting in HCV persistence or the resistance to IFN-based therapy.
